Registry Trust has announced that Mick McAteer Deputy Chair. Registry Trust is a non-profit organisation which collects decree and judgment information from jurisdictions across the British Isles and Ireland. McAteer, who has been an independent director of the Trust since 2016, takes up the position with immediate effect. Malcolm Hurlston CBE remains chairman He is…

TransUnion announces Noddle sale to Credit Karma

5th November 2018 Consumer Collections |

TransUnion, the global risk and information solutions provider, has announced it has an agreement to sell its Noddle business, the UK-based free-for-life credit reporting and monitoring service, to Credit Karma. TransUnion acquired Noddle earlier this year as part of its acquisition of Callcredit, the second largest credit reference agency in the UK. John Danaher, TransUnion’s…
